Last day students can add or substitute F-term or Y-term courses on ACORN. For the complete list of sessional dates, visit the Engineering Academic Calendar. Deadline to designate a Fall Term (F-term) or Y-term "Extra" course as a credit course. For the complete list of sessional dates, visit the Engineering Academic Calendar. PEY Co-op Program: Last day to withdraw from the PEY Co-op Program for students in Year 3 of study. For more information about PEY Co-op, visit the Engineering Career Centre (ECC). |
1 event,
PEY Co-op Program: Career Portal with 2025-2026 job postings opens to qualified students seeking 12-16 month work terms. Interviews, job offers and acceptances begin shortly after. For more information about PEY Co-op, visit the Engineering Career Centre (ECC). |
